RB 84/00100 Palynostratigraphy of Argonaut A1, Lake Bonney 1 and Kalangadoo 1 wells, Otway Basin.
16 samples produced sparse, poorly preserved microfloras. In Argonaut-A1 palynofloras are correlated with Late Cretaceous and Eocene zones, with an unconformity between Cretaceous and Tertiary. Local unconformities may occur in the Campanian section....-

RB 73/00265 GENEX Douglas Point no. 1 well. Palynological examination of sidewall cores.
Palynological examination of 30 sidewall cores from GENEX Douglas Point No. 1 well over the Cretaceous - Tertiary boundary indicates a hiatus representative of the Lower and much of the Middle Paleocene. The Curdies Formation correlates with the...-
